To connect different scenes and elements in their music video, the document discusses several video editing techniques the authors used, including:
1) Flashing between clips to capture attention and fill space while showing a narrative.
2) Using black and white/grayscale video filters to represent flashbacks between past and present events.
3) Incorporating a range of camera angles and costume changes to keep the audience engaged and give the video a more professional look.
4) Adding glow and tint video filters to transition between the chorus and bridge and link footage with the song's effect.
